Foundation Inspection in Sarasota, FL
Foundation inspection services provide a thorough assessment of a property's structural base to identify any signs of damage, shifting, or deterioration. These inspections are often requested during property transactions, after noticing cracks or uneven floors, or as part of routine maintenance for older homes. The process typically involves visual evaluations and measurements to determine the stability of the foundation, helping homeowners understand whether repairs or further evaluations might be necessary.
Property owners usually seek foundation inspections to gain clarity about the condition of their home's base before making significant decisions, such as selling, purchasing, or planning renovations. Common concerns include cracks in walls or floors, uneven surfaces, or visible signs of settling. Understanding the foundation's state can assist homeowners in making informed choices about repairs, ensuring the safety and stability of their property.

Foundation Inspection Questions
What signs indicate a foundation may need inspection? C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, or doors that stick can suggest foundation issues requiring assessment.
Why is a foundation inspection important for homeowners? It helps identify potential problems early, preventing costly repairs and ensuring property stability.
What types of properties typically require foundation inspections? Residential homes, especially older properties or those experiencing settling, often benefit from foundation evaluations.
What should property owners expect during a foundation inspection? A professional will examine visible structural elements, check for cracks or shifts, and assess overall stability of the foundation.
